Mosaic is a child-centred service offering a pathway of support for bereaved children, young people and their families. We offer support pre-bereavement, post bereavement and immediately following a bereavement.

WebThe Children’s Therapy Service is made up of specialist Occupational Therapists and Physiotherapists. These members of staff are responsible for the assessment and treatment of children from ages of 0 to 19 years, with disabilities and conditions in the Poole, Bournemouth and East Dorset area.
